Parcel Panel Order Tracking and PostCo Returns & Exchanges, while both listed under the 'Shipping' category in the Shopify App Store, cater to very different post-purchase needs of e-commerce merchants in 2026. Parcel Panel Order Tracking focuses on enhancing the customer experience by providing a seamless order tracking solution, allowing customers to easily monitor their shipment's progress. PostCo Returns & Exchanges, on the other hand, simplifies the often-challenging process of managing returns and exchanges for both merchants and their customers. The primary difference lies in their functionality: order tracking versus returns management. Parcel Panel aims to reduce customer anxiety and support requests related to shipping inquiries, while PostCo aims to streamline the returns process, potentially increasing customer satisfaction and repeat purchases. The significantly higher number of reviews (1947 vs. 79) for Parcel Panel indicates a broader user base and potentially a longer market presence or wider applicability across different types of online stores, but the 5/5 rating for both suggests a high level of user satisfaction within their respective niches. Considering the rating and reviews, both solutions seem effective. However, the volume of reviews heavily favors Parcel Panel, suggesting either more broad appeal or an app that solves a more ubiquitous problem for online merchants.

For merchants prioritizing proactive customer communication and reducing 'Where is my order?' inquiries, Parcel Panel Order Tracking is the stronger choice. The significantly higher number of reviews indicates a wider adoption and likely broader applicability across various business types. Its focus on order tracking addresses a fundamental need for almost all online retailers.
However, for merchants experiencing a high volume of returns or seeking to streamline a complex returns process to improve customer satisfaction and potentially retain revenue, PostCo Returns & Exchanges is the better option. While its review count is lower, the 5/5 rating suggests it effectively addresses the specific needs of businesses grappling with returns management. Ultimately, the choice depends on the merchant's specific pain points and priorities.
